1. Nismo CAI ($250)
2. STRUP header ($400)
3. STRUP test pipe ($150)
4. Nismo Exhaust ($900)
5. Plenum Spacer ($250)
6. Unichip ($900)
That is for your engine performance mod up.

Svrtech exhaust, MREV+, strup header, Popcharger, JWT S1 cams/shims, UTEC... 285ish whp maybe more right there.
Svrtech exhaust comes w/ test pipes, it has an X pipe integerated and uses Aeroturbine mufflers, no glass packing- all ceramic baby!. The integerated x pipe will prevent all rasp and drone, which nismo exhaust w/ HFC or test pipes are known for.. That setup up there is my dream NA setup! My N/A recommendation:
1) Motordyne MREV2 + 5/16" Spacer
2) K&N Panel Filter
3) 3.9 Final Drive
4) Stillen Exhaust
That's my dream setup. I don't want to cat delete and don't know how well the RT cats work. I prefer the stock intake setup to a pop or cai.
If you get good gas like 93, you should yield decent gains from those mods, and your overall drivability and noise levels should be perfect. The 3.9 FD will make your car a lot quicker.
That's the setup I would go for. I think the return on investment after that is minimal. You could do cams and ecu, maybe clutch and flywheel, but I don't know if it's worth it.
